froggyluv 2130 Posted August 31, 2009 I'll try:p The missions that you would normally put into your Arma2 missions have to be compiled into pbo format. For whatever reason, this mission was released uncompiled- aka, it's still a folder. Folder's you can only play in the editor, so you could just place it in 'Yourname/Documents/Arma2/Missions and should show up in you editor OR you would have to get a 'create pbo tool', then compile it yourself. If they are mission files be sure that the name contains the island name too. For example: - missionname.pbo won't show - missionname.utes.pbo will show as playable cause it tells the game that it's for the Utes island. Of course u will have to know the island name or guess it.
